mysql用戶(hù)密碼如何重新設(shè)置?

mysql用戶(hù)密碼如何重新設(shè)置?

mysql用戶(hù)密碼重新設(shè)置

停掉mysql服務(wù):

sudo?service?mysql?stop

以上命令適用于Ubuntu和Debian。CentOS、Fedora和RHEL下使用mysqld替換mysql。
以安全模式啟動(dòng)mysql:

sudo?mysqld_safe?--skip-grant-tables?--skip-networking?&

這樣我們就可以直接用root登錄,無(wú)需密碼:

mysql?-u?root

重設(shè)密碼:

mysql>?use?mysql;?mysql>?update?user?set password=PASSWORD("mynewpassword")?where?User='root';?mysql>?flush privileges;

注意,命令后需要加分號(hào)。

重設(shè)完畢后,我們退出,然后啟動(dòng)mysql服務(wù):

mysql?>?quit

quit不需要分號(hào)。

重啟服務(wù):

sudo?service?mysql?restart

同樣,以上命令適用于Ubuntu和Debian,Centos、Fedora和RHEL需要用mysqld替換mysql。

推薦教程: 《mysql教程

以上就是

? 版權(quán)聲明
THE END
喜歡就支持一下吧
點(diǎn)贊13 分享
站長(zhǎng)的頭像-小浪學(xué)習(xí)網(wǎng)月度會(huì)員